Poaching remains one of the biggest threats to wildlife populations worldwide, but advances in technology are offering new ways to combat this illegal activity. You might think that protecting animals in vast, often remote habitats is intimidating, but innovative tools like AI surveillance and drone patrols are changing the game. These technologies allow you to monitor large areas more efficiently, detect intruders quickly, and respond before the poachers can cause harm. AI-powered surveillance systems analyze visual and thermal data in real time, helping you identify suspicious movements or individuals in protected zones. Unlike traditional patrols that rely on guesswork and limited visibility, AI algorithms can sift through hours of footage or live feeds, flagging potential threats instantly. This means you can act swiftly, increasing the chances of intercepting poachers before they succeed.

AI and drone tech revolutionize wildlife protection by enabling rapid detection and response to poaching threats.

Drone patrols add another powerful layer to your defense strategy. Equipped with high-resolution cameras and thermal imaging, drones can cover vast terrains swiftly, reaching areas that are difficult for ground teams to access. As you deploy these unmanned aircraft, they continuously scan for signs of illegal activity, transmitting real-time footage back to your command center. Because drones can hover for extended periods and navigate challenging landscapes, you gain a dynamic and persistent presence in the field. This not only acts as a deterrent for would-be poachers but also provides essential intelligence for your teams to plan targeted interventions. Plus, drones can be programmed to follow predefined routes or respond to alerts from AI surveillance systems, creating a seamless, integrated security network.

Together, AI surveillance and drone patrols empower you to proactively safeguard wildlife, rather than just respond to incidents after they happen. You can set up automated alerts that notify your team the moment suspicious activity is detected, allowing for rapid deployment of ground patrols or other resources. This proactive approach minimizes the window of opportunity for poachers, making illegal hunting less feasible. Additionally, the data collected through these technologies helps you analyze poaching patterns, identify hotspots, and allocate resources more effectively over time. As technology advances, so does your ability to stay one step ahead of those who threaten wildlife. Moreover, AI can assist in predicting poaching trends, enabling you to implement preventative measures before illegal activities occur.

How Do Anti-Poaching Drones Navigate Difficult Terrains?

You might wonder how anti-poaching drones navigate tough terrains. They use advanced aerial mapping and terrain adaptation technology to overcome obstacles like dense forests or rugged mountains. These drones analyze the landscape in real-time, adjusting their flight paths to stay on course and avoid hazards. With GPS guidance and obstacle detection, you can trust these drones to effectively monitor remote areas, ensuring wildlife protection even in the most challenging environments.

How Do Poachers Counteract Surveillance Technology?

Poachers counteract surveillance technology by employing counter surveillance tactics, such as avoiding camera ranges or using noise to disrupt sensors. They also resort to illegal technology use, like jamming signals or hacking devices, to disable monitoring systems. You need to stay ahead by continuously updating detection methods, understanding their tactics, and deploying adaptive security measures. This ongoing cat-and-mouse game requires innovation and vigilance to protect wildlife effectively.
